Sunday, November 24, 2024

Tag: Yolanda Sanchez Figueroa

Political Triumph Shadowed by Tragedy: The Assassination of Yolanda Sánchez Figueroa

Just hours after Mexico elected its first female president in a historic move, a sitting female mayor was brutally...